A delayer is a processor that enables you to apply a relative time delay to incoming messages.
You can use the delay()
command to add a relative time
delay, in units of milliseconds, to incoming messages. For example, the following route
delays all incoming messages by 2 seconds:
from("seda:a").delay(2000).to("mock:result");
Alternatively, you can specify the time delay using an expression:
from("seda:a").delay(header("MyDelay")).to("mock:result");
The DSL commands that follow delay()
are interpreted as sub-clauses of
delay()
. Hence, in some contexts it is necessary to terminate the sub-clauses
of delay() by inserting the end()
command. For example, when
delay()
appears inside an onException()
clause, you would
terminate it as follows:
from("direct:start") .onException(Exception.class) .maximumRedeliveries(2) .backOffMultiplier(1.5) .handled(true) .delay(1000) .log("Halting for some time") .to("mock:halt") .end() .end() .to("mock:result");
The following example demonstrates the delay in XML DSL:
<camelContext xmlns="http://camel.apache.org/schema/spring"> <route> <from uri="seda:a"/> <delay> <header>MyDelay</header> </delay> <to uri="mock:result"/> </route> <route> <from uri="seda:b"/> <delay> <constant>1000</constant> </delay> <to uri="mock:result"/> </route> </camelContext>
You can use an expression combined with a bean to determine the delay as follows:
from("activemq:foo"). delay().expression().method("someBean", "computeDelay"). to("activemq:bar");
Where the bean class could be defined as follows:
public class SomeBean { public long computeDelay() { long delay = 0; // use java code to compute a delay value in millis return delay; } }
You can let the delayer use non-blocking asynchronous delaying, which means that Fuse Mediation Router schedules a task to be executed in the future. The task is responsible for processing the latter part of the route (after the delayer). This allows the caller thread to unblock and service further incoming messages. For example:
from("activemq:queue:foo") .delay(1000) .asyncDelayed() .to("activemq:aDelayedQueue");
The same route can be written in the XML DSL, as follows:
<route> <from uri="activemq:queue:foo"/> <delay asyncDelayed="true"> <constant>1000</constant> </delay> <to uri="activemq:aDealyedQueue"/> </route>
The delayer pattern supports the following options:
Name | Default Value | Description |
---|---|---|
asyncDelayed
|
false
|
Camel 2.4: If enabled then delayed messages happens asynchronously using a scheduled thread pool. |
executorServiceRef
|
Camel 2.4: Refers to a custom Thread Pool to be used if asyncDelay has been enabled. |
|
callerRunsWhenRejected
|
true
|
Camel 2.4: Is used if asyncDelayed was enabled. This controls if the caller thread should execute the task if the thread pool rejected the task. |
